Brief summary
The objective of this single arm interventional study is to determine if renal denervation performed in the distal main and first order branch renal arteries is as effective in reducing blood pressure as the procedural approach used in the SPYRAL HTN-OFF MED clinical study.
Interventions
Device: Symplicity Spyral™ multi-electrode renal denervation system. After a renal angiography according to standard procedures, subjects are treated with the renal denervation procedure.

Eligibility
Inclusion criteria
\- Individual has office systolic blood pressure (SBP) ≥ 150 mmHg and \<180 mmHg and a diastolic blood pressure (DBP) ≥ 90 mmHg after being off medications. * Individual has 24-hour Ambulatory Blood Pressure Monitoring (ABPM) average SBP ≥ 140 mmHg and \< 170 mmHg. * Individual is willing to discontinue current antihypertensive medications
Exclusion criteria
* Individual has estimated glomerular filtration rate (eGFR) of \<45. * Individual has type 1 diabetes mellitus or poorly-controlled type 2 diabetes mellitus. * Individual has one or more episodes of orthostatic hypotension. * Individual requires chronic oxygen support or mechanical ventilation other than nocturnal respiratory support for sleep apnea. * Individual has primary pulmonary hypertension. * Individual is pregnant, nursing or planning to become pregnant. * Individual has frequent intermittent or chronic pain that results in treatment with nonsteroidal anti-inflammatory drugs (NSAIDs) for two or more days per week over the month prior to enrollment. * Individual has stable or unstable angina within 3 months of enrollment, myocardial infarction within 3 months of enrollment; heart failure, cerebrovascular accident or transient ischemic attack, or atrial fibrillation at any time. * Individual works night shifts.

Outcome results
Change in Systolic Blood Pressure (SBP) as Measured by 24-hour Ambulatory Blood Pressure Monitoring (ABPM)
Time frame: From Baseline (SV2) to 12 months post-procedure
Population: Subjects with evaluable data
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| Renal Denervation | Change in Systolic Blood Pressure (SBP) as Measured by 24-hour Ambulatory Blood Pressure Monitoring (ABPM) | -16.6 mmHg | Standard Deviation 10.6 |

Procedural Characteristics: Amount of Contrast Used (cc)
Comparison of the procedural characteristics: amount of contrast used (cubic centimeter(cc)) between the SPYRAL DYSTAL study and the SPYRAL HTN-OFF MED study (NCT02439749) who, after a renal angiography according to standard procedures, are treated with the renal denervation procedure.
Time frame: Procedure
Population: 56 Subjects from the SPYRAL DYSTAL study and 178 Subjects from the SPYRAL HTN-OFF MED study (NCT02439749) with evaluable data.
| Arm | Measure | Group | Value (MEAN) | Dispersion |
|---|---|---|---|---|
| Renal Denervation | Procedural Characteristics: Amount of Contrast Used (cc) | SPYRAL DYSTAL | 172.8 (cubic centimeter(cc)) | Standard Deviation 76.6 |
| Renal Denervation | Procedural Characteristics: Amount of Contrast Used (cc) | SPYRAL HTN-OFF MED | 207.8 (cubic centimeter(cc)) | Standard Deviation 96.1 |
Procedural Characteristics: Denervation Time (Minutes)
Comparison of the procedural characteristics: total denervation time between the SPYRAL DYSTAL study and the SPYRAL HTN-OFF MED study (NCT02439749) who, after a renal angiography according to standard procedures, are treated with the renal denervation procedure.
Time frame: Procedure
Population: 56 Subjects from the SPYRAL DYSTAL study and 182 Subjects from the SPYRAL HTN-OFF MED study (NCT02439749).
| Arm | Measure | Group | Value (MEAN) | Dispersion |
|---|---|---|---|---|
| Renal Denervation | Procedural Characteristics: Denervation Time (Minutes) | SPYRAL DYSTAL | 35.9 Minutes | Standard Deviation 13.8 |
| Renal Denervation | Procedural Characteristics: Denervation Time (Minutes) | SPYRAL HTN-OFF MED | 59.7 Minutes | Standard Deviation 24.3 |
Procedural Characteristics: Procedure Time (Minutes)
Comparison of procedural characteristics: total procedure duration (minutes) between the SPYRAL DYSTAL study and the SPYRAL HTN-OFF MED study (NCT02439749) who, after a renal angiography according to standard procedures, are treated with the renal denervation procedure.
Time frame: Procedure
Population: 56 Subjects from the SPYRAL DYSTAL study and 182 Subjects from the SPYRAL HTN-OFF MED study (NCT02439749).
| Arm | Measure | Group | Value (MEAN) | Dispersion |
|---|---|---|---|---|
| Renal Denervation | Procedural Characteristics: Procedure Time (Minutes) | SPYRAL DYSTAL | 67.3 Minutes | Standard Deviation 20.6 |
| Renal Denervation | Procedural Characteristics: Procedure Time (Minutes) | SPYRAL HTN-OFF MED | 99.3 Minutes | Standard Deviation 36.2 |
